Today our feature is the Lanvin daytime to evening suit and accessories.
One of our favorite French designers is Alber Elbaz, the designer for the house of Lanvin. Elbaz who had previously worked with Geoffrey Beene and Yves St.Laurent has been the artistic director at Lanvin since 2001.
Lanvin’s elegant daytime to evening suit above has emerged as a major direction for suiting this season and next year. The style evokes a 40′s feel with exagerated shoulder, fitted jacket and belted waist. The modern twist comes in the form of the architecturally draped,slit skirt. The accessories as well, marry the classic with a twist. The gloves and headpiece evoke the glamour of an earlier era, while the platform booties say 2010.
